How Yonkers Plumbers Charge for Their Services

Understanding how plumbers structure their pricing is the first step to understanding what your bill will look like:

Service Call / Dispatch Fee

Most Yonkers plumbers charge a service call fee — sometimes called a dispatch fee or trip charge — that covers the cost of sending a licensed plumber to your home. This fee typically ranges from $75 to $150 for standard business-hours calls and is higher for after-hours, weekend, and holiday emergency calls. The service call fee is charged regardless of whether you proceed with the repair, though some plumbers waive it if you authorize the repair.

Hourly Labor Rate

Some plumbers charge by the hour after the service call fee. Licensed plumber hourly rates in Yonkers and Westchester County typically range from $125 to $200 per hour, with higher rates for specialized work or after-hours service. Hourly billing requires you to trust the plumber's time estimates and creates some uncertainty about total cost before work begins.

Flat-Rate / Upfront Pricing

Many plumbing companies, including Pure Luro Plumbing Yonkers, use flat-rate pricing for common services. With flat-rate pricing, the plumber assesses your situation and quotes a fixed price for the complete job — regardless of how long it takes. This provides cost certainty before work begins. The trade-off is that flat-rate pricing on complex jobs may be higher than actual time and materials would suggest, while on quick jobs it may be exactly right.

Time and Materials

Some plumbing contractors charge for the actual labor time plus the actual cost of materials used, with a markup on materials. This can be the most economical approach on complex, unpredictable jobs but provides less cost certainty upfront.

Typical Plumbing Service Costs in Yonkers

The following cost ranges reflect typical pricing for common plumbing services in Yonkers, NY during standard business hours. After-hours emergency service adds significantly to these base costs.

Drain Cleaning

  • Bathroom sink drain cleaning: $100-$200
  • Kitchen drain cleaning: $150-$250
  • Main sewer line cleaning (cable): $200-$400
  • Main sewer line hydro-jetting: $300-$600
  • Sewer video inspection: $150-$300

Toilet Repair and Replacement

  • Running toilet repair (flapper/fill valve): $100-$200
  • Toilet wax ring replacement: $150-$300
  • Toilet clog clearing: $100-$250
  • Toilet replacement (standard): $300-$600 including fixture
  • Toilet replacement (higher-end fixture): $500-$1,200 including fixture

Faucet and Fixture Service

  • Faucet repair (cartridge replacement, etc.): $100-$250
  • Faucet replacement (standard fixture): $200-$450
  • Shower valve repair: $200-$500
  • Shower valve replacement: $350-$800
  • Bathtub faucet repair: $150-$350

Water Heater Services

  • Water heater diagnostic and repair (minor): $150-$350
  • Water heater repair (thermocouple, element, etc.): $200-$500
  • Tank water heater replacement (30-40 gal gas): $900-$1,500 installed
  • Tank water heater replacement (50+ gal gas): $1,100-$1,800 installed
  • Tankless water heater installation: $1,500-$3,500 installed

Pipe Repair and Replacement

  • Minor pipe repair (accessible): $150-$350
  • Pipe repair inside wall (drywall opening required): $300-$700
  • Slab leak repair: $800-$3,000+ depending on approach
  • Whole-house repiping: $4,000-$15,000+ depending on home size

Emergency Plumbing (After-Hours)

  • Emergency service call fee (after-hours): $150-$300
  • Emergency pipe repair: $400-$1,500
  • Emergency water heater replacement: Add $200-$400 to standard cost
  • Emergency main sewer clearing: $300-$600

Factors That Affect Plumbing Costs in Yonkers

Time of Day and Day of Week

The biggest single factor that can increase plumbing costs in Yonkers is timing. Standard business hours (typically 8 AM to 5 PM Monday-Friday) command base rates. Evening, weekend, and holiday calls carry premium rates — typically 25-75% above base rates. True 24/7 emergency calls at odd hours on holidays can command the highest rates of all. This is not price gouging — it reflects the real cost of maintaining staffing for round-the-clock service.

Accessibility of the Problem

Plumbing work in accessible locations — under sinks, in visible basement areas, on exposed pipe runs — is significantly less expensive than work that requires opening walls, digging up floors, or working in confined crawl spaces. The labor time to access and repair an equivalent problem can vary enormously based on how accessible the affected pipe or fixture is.

Age and Condition of Existing Plumbing

Working on older plumbing systems — galvanized steel pipes, older fixtures, deteriorated fittings — often takes longer and involves more complications than working on newer systems. Corroded connections that should take minutes to loosen may take significantly longer. This is a particular consideration for older Yonkers homes with original mid-20th century plumbing.

Materials Required

The cost and complexity of materials significantly affects plumbing repair costs. Replacing a standard faucet washer costs pennies; replacing a custom thermostatic shower valve costs hundreds of dollars. Repairing a 10-foot section of 3/4" copper pipe requires more material than repairing a 2-foot section, and the material cost difference is reflected in the estimate.

Permit Requirements

Certain plumbing work in Yonkers requires permits from the City of Yonkers Building Department. Water heater replacement, new fixture installation, and any significant pipe work typically requires permits. Permit costs in Yonkers vary by scope of work but typically range from $75 to $400 or more. Reputable plumbers include permit costs in their estimates for work that requires them.

How to Get Fair Plumbing Pricing in Yonkers

Always Get a Written Estimate

Before authorizing any plumbing work, insist on a written estimate that itemizes labor and materials. Verbal quotes are difficult to enforce if the final bill is different. A written estimate protects both you and the plumber by establishing clear expectations before work begins.

Understand What Is Included

Ask specifically what the estimate includes and excludes. Does it include permit fees? Does it include drywall repair if walls need to be opened? Does it include cleanup and disposal of old fixtures? Understanding the scope of what is quoted prevents misunderstandings later.

Do Not Always Choose the Lowest Bid

The lowest plumbing bid in Yonkers is not always the best value. Very low bids sometimes reflect unlicensed operators who cannot be held accountable, use of substandard materials, cutting corners on permit requirements, or lack of insurance. The cost of fixing a botched plumbing job can significantly exceed the original savings.

Ask About Workmanship Guarantees

A reputable Yonkers plumber stands behind their work with a warranty. Ask specifically what workmanship guarantee is provided and what it covers. This is a standard feature of quality plumbing services and its absence is a concern.
